Hi Kwan, re: > The newly installed McIDAS appears to work fine. One question that I have > is: do I need to create a local ADDE linux account in order to access > remote ADDE servers? No. Creation of the 'mcadde' account is only needed if you intend to serve local ADDE datasets to remote clients. re: > I am interested in the availability of global lightning data via ADDE > servers. After a brief Google search, it appears that access to the > lightning data is restricted. Is that the case? Yes, use/distribution of both NLDN and USPLN lightning data is restricted by the providers of those data. U.S. Unidata universities can get a free point-to-point LDM/IDD feed of either/both datasets, but they have to agree that the data will not be made available in any form outside of their campus. Any other use of the data will jeopardize the free availability of the data for all of those Unidata universities.
